I just want to share with those that read this blog (or bump into it!) that I have started a new blog today (January 9th, 2008) entitled e-Learning in Malaysia. It is kind of empty right now (except for a few interesting links and posts), but as I learn over the coming months (and perhaps years), I believe it will evolve into a useful blog to find e-learning related things going on in Malaysia.
I hope this blog will eventually evolve into a good starting point to discover e-learning things going on in Malaysia (that is accessible to the public). My new learning adventure (in addition to ZaidLearn) will try to mash-up the juiciest e-learning stories going on in Malaysia (past, present, future), including:
- Higher Education (Universities & Colleges)
- Schools (Primary & Secondary)
- Corporate Learning
- Communities
- Projects
- Solution Providers
- Research Papers & Articles
- People
- Conferences
- Blogs
- Etc.
In short, the main goal for setting up this blog, is to discover, learn, share, discuss, network, and reflect about e-learning in Malaysia. Click here to read the full story behind this blog.
